Re: FIFA are considering scrapping the offside rule

Wonder how a game would play without the offside rule, will attackers stay at one end of the pitch, the defense back with them, with the midfield doing a lot more running? Will it be long ball ahoy? Or will it remain much the same but teams would need to cover faster players better in the absence of the offside trap?

I am for anything that increases the flow of the game and makes it more exciting.

Re: FIFA are considering scrapping the offside rule

I'd prefer something like in Ice Hockey, the "pitch" in thirds with the 2 dividing lines being an offside line and you're only offside if you're in your teams offensive third when the puck/ball enters it. Linesmen will then have a definitive line to look along and won't have to be looking in 2 places at once making the decisions easier.
